I don't use the seat cushion a lot (mostly on longer road trips when my backside starts to get numb or hurt) but from the times that I have used it, it helped me ride a little longer and reduced any pains or uncomfortableness. The factory seat is pretty comfortable so I use this sparingly and only when needed. I agree with what most say about this seat cushion and that is, you don't want to fully inflate the bladders because that will make you feel like you're floating above the seat and you lose the connected feeling with the bike. Just add enough air to just get your body off the seat and that should be enough. When not in use, I just store it in my top case. Overall, its far cheaper than a custom seat and looks better than s sheepskin pad so yes, I have to say I am pleased with the purchase.
